志深入理解 Oracle 日志管理(oracle日)

Oracle 数据库是一种强大的组件,它可以改善和保护我们的软件,帮助我们控制我们的软件环境等。 以及有一套先进的日志管理系统来帮助管理分析系统的活动。 因此,全面的理解Oracle日志管理系统将有助于我们更好地管理、控制、监控系统。

Oracle 日志管理系统是一种功能强大的工具,它可以为我们提供完整有用的信息,以了解Oracle系统的内部活动,包括用户对表的查询、插入、更新、删除等数据库操作,有助于检查、定位及解决系统的问题,并提供重要的数据,以便改善系统的性能。

Oracle日志管理系统的实现一般遵循以下步骤:

1.首先,在oracle服务器上创建一个包含存储信息的目录,用来存放日志。可以使用以下SQL语句创建该目录:

“`

CREATE OR REPLACE DIRECTORY LOG_DATA

AS ‘/CHIP-DEVELOP/LOG’;

“`

2.生成日志文件。如果要创建一个指定名称的日志文件,可以使用下面的SQL语句,将其存放在上面创建的LOG_DATA目录中:

ALTER DATABASE
ADD LOGFILE
GROUP 4
('/CHIP-DEVELOP/LOG/test_log.log')
SIZE 2000M;

3. 然后使用SQL语句ALTER SYSTEM SET LOG_ARCHIVE_DEST_4=’LOCATION=/CHIP-DEVELOP/LOG’或ALTER DATABASE SETLogArchiveTrace=16385来启动日志跟踪功能。用这些SQL语句可以灵活地配置日志管理系统。

4.之后,用SQL语句SELECT LOGFILE_NAME, LOGFILE_TYPE, STATUS FROM V$LOGFILE查看状态,检查是否成功创建日志文件,以及是否启动跟踪功能。

最后,使用SQL语句ALTER SYSTEM ARCHIVE LOG CURRENT来完成日志归档,这可以帮助我们维护更新后的数据库。

总之,通过理解Oracle日志管理系统可以更好地管理我们的系统,以及实现Oracle系统的有效管理。


数据运维技术 » 志深入理解 Oracle 日志管理(oracle日)